1. Calculating Aquarium Volume
The fundamental metric for any aquarium job is figuring out the precise volume of water it holds. Makers frequently identify tanks by their exterior measurements, however the real water volume is typically lower due to substrate, decoration, and the area left at the top of the tank.
Standard Tank Shape Formulas
To find the volume, one need to determine the interior dimensions in inches or centimeters.
Tank ShapeFormula (Dimensions in Inches)Formula (Dimensions in Centimeters)Rectangular₤(Length times Width times Height) div 231 ₤₤(Length times Width times Height) div 1,000 ₤Cylindrical₤( pi times Radius ^ 2 times Height) n 231 ₤₤( pi times Radius ^ 2 n Height) div 1,000 ₤Bow-Front₤(Length times [Width + Center Width] div 2 times Height) div 231 ₤(Use average width estimate)
Note: Dividing by 231 converts cubic inches into US gallons. Dividing by 1,000 converts cubic centimeters into liters.
Factoring in Displacement
Water volume is more reduced by physical things inside the tank. As a general general rule:
- Substrate (gravel/sand): Reduces total volume by about 10-- 20%.
- Hardscape (rocks/wood): Reduces volume based on displacement (roughly 5-- 10%).
2. Water Change Calculators: Diluting Nitrates
Nitrates are completion product of the nitrogen cycle. While less poisonous than ammonia and nitrite, high nitrate levels trigger tension and illness in fish. Routine water modifications are the main method for minimizing nitrates.
An Diy Aquarium Stand Calculator water calculator can assist figure out just how much water needs to be replaced to reach a target nitrate level. The fundamental formula for dilution is:
₤ ₤ text Final Nitrate = text Initial Nitrate times left(1 - frac text Water Changed text Total Tank Volume right)₤ ₤
Common Water Change Scenarios
To make maintenance much easier, many hobbyists count on standard replacement schedules.
- Upkeep Change (20%): Removes accumulated organic waste and renews trace minerals without stunning the biological filter.
- Emergency Change (50%+): Used when ammonia or nitrite spikes take place due to a crashed cycle or overfeeding.
- Post-Medication Change (30-- 45%): Helps clear residual chemical treatments from the water column.
3. Equipping Capacity Calculators
Among the oldest rules in fish keeping was the "one inch of fish per gallon of water" rule. Modern aquarists know this rule is deeply flawed. A 10-inch Oscar fish can not reside in a 10-gallon tank, despite the fact that the math fits, since of its biological waste output, territorial requirements, and physical size.
A contemporary stocking calculator assesses numerous factors:
- Adult Size: Calculating based on how large the fish will grow, not its size at purchase.
- Bioload: Fish that produce more waste (like goldfish and cichlids) need more water volume than streamlined education fish (like tetras).
- Education Requirements: Many fish need groups of 6 or more to feel secure, which affects the minimum tank size.
- Filtration Capacity: High-flow, effective filters can support a slightly greater bioload, though they never ever change water modifications.
4. Temperature and Heater Calculators
Maintaining a steady water temperature is important, specifically for tropical and marine setups. Quick temperature level drops can weaken a fish's immune system and trigger diseases like Ich.
Wattage Recommendations
A general general rule for Aquarium Weight Calculator heating units is 3 to 5 watts of power per gallon of water. Nevertheless, this depends on the ambient room temperature.
- Moderate Room Temperature: If the space is roughly 70 ° F( 21 ° C )and the tank needs to be 78 ° F(25 ° C ), a standard 5W-per-gallon ratio works well.
- Cool Room Temperature: If the room is drafty or cold, a greater wattage or dual-heater setup is suggested to prevent the heating unit from continuously running and failing.
- Nano Tanks: Tanks under 5 gallons typically require specific mini-heaters with predetermined temperatures to avoid getting too hot.
5. Chemical Dosing and Salinity Calculators
When dealing with diseases or establishing a marine aquarium, precision is non-negotiable.
Medication Dosing
Most medications are dosed per 10 gallons (or liters) of real water volume. Overdosing can quickly eliminate sensitive fish and invertebrates. Constantly determine based on the actual water volume (accounting for substrate and decor) rather than the tank's rated size.
Salinity (Specific Gravity) for Saltwater Tanks
Marine fish tanks need exact salt blends measured by specific gravity (SG), typically in between 1.023 and 1.025.
- When mixing brand-new saltwater, calculators assist figure out the precise grams or cups of marine salt mix needed for a particular volume of RO/DI (Reverse Osmosis/Deionized) water.
- For top-offs due to evaporation, bear in mind that salt does not evaporate; just distilled water does. For that reason, top-off water must be freshwater, not saltwater, to prevent salinity spikes.
